Profitability
The ability of a business to earn a profit, which occurs when the revenues generated exceed the costs and expenses incurred in operating the business.
Financial Indicators
Financial indicators are quantitative measures that provide insights into the financial health, performance, and stability of an organization or business.
Accountability
The obligation of an individual or organization to account for its activities, accept responsibility for them, and disclose the results in a transparent manner.
Regulatory Compliance
Adhering to laws, regulations, guidelines, and specifications relevant to business operations or activities.
